My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

Meet Mamba! 🐾🖤

Mamba is a fabulous 7-year-old French Bulldog with a big personality packed into a compact, wrinkly, and oh-so-cute body. With his signature squishy face and expressive eyes, he’s impossible to resist!

Mamba is a confident and affectionate boy who loves being around his people. Whether he’s strutting his stuff on a walk, lounging like royalty, or soaking up belly rubs, Mamba does it all in true Frenchie style.

Additional adoption info

You can view our available animals online or by visiting the shelter during regular business hours. Our knowledgeable and compassionate staff are here to guide you through the adoption process, which includes completing an application and having a conversation to ensure you’re fully informed and prepared to welcome a new pet into your home.

If you find an animal on our website that you’re interested in, we kindly ask that you visit the shelter to meet them in person before submitting your application. This helps ensure the best possible match for both you and the animal.

More about this shelter

The Gulf Coast Humane Society is a private, non-profit 501(c)(3) animal welfare organization dedicated to serving the animals and community of Southwest Florida. We receive no federal, state, or county funding, nor do we receive financial support from the Humane Society of the United States. Instead, our lifesaving work is made possible through the generosity of individual donations, grants, bequests, and community fundraising efforts.

As a no kill shelter, Gulf Coast Humane Society is committed to providing compassionate care for unwanted, neglected, and abandoned animals. We never euthanize due to space constraints or the length of time an animal has been in our care. Our mission is to give every animal the second chance they deserve in a safe and loving environment.
